Retrofitting and recommissioning for syngas applications
Application | Compression of synthesis gas for gas engines
Country | Netherlands
Challenge
An existing reciprocating compressor was originally designed for compressing natural gas. To enable its use with synthesis gas, the system had to be adapted to meet new requirements and commissioned safely.
Solution
Through a targeted retrofit, an existing compressor can be adapted to new gas types and applications.
In doing so, all relevant components are designed to meet the new operating conditions in order to ensure safe and reliable operation.
Implementation in the Netherlands
A second-hand piston compressor was retrofitted for use with synthesis gas. The Mehrer Service Team carried out the necessary modifications and successfully recommissioned the plant.
In doing so, they ensured that the entire process, including the downstream gas engine, functions reliably and can be operated stably.
Results
- Successful conversion to synthesis gas
- Recommissioning of the existing plant
- Reliable operation of the entire system
- Extended service life of the existing equipment
| Series | TEL 50 |
| Description | single-stage, single-acting |
| Suction pressure | 1,1 bar(a) |
| Final pressure | 4,0 bar(a) |
| Volume flow | 15 cubic metres per hour |
| Gas state | dry |
| Cooling | air-cooled |
